Juventus changes and similarities as Tudor prepares for debut after Motta sacking

Dusan Vlahovic is expected to start for Juventus in Igor Tudor’s debut against Genoa, while Manuel Locatelli will remain the captain and could even start in defence.

Juventus are preparing for Tudor’s debut on the Juventus bench as the Bianconeri host Genoa at the Allianz Stadium on Saturday.

The biggest line-up change is believed to be in attack, with Vlahovic starting the game.

The Juventus leading scorer has only played 455 minutes in 2025 under Thiago Motta. The ex-Juventus boss often picked January signing Randal Kolo Muani over the Serbia international, who only started four times in the new year, twice when his French teammate was unavailable.

Vlahovic seems highly motivated to get a fresh start under Tudor, as he was one of the Juventus players returning to the training ground ahead of schedule after the international break.

Tudor praised Vlahovic during his unveiling press conference on Thursday and had previously said the Serbian was the best striker in Serie A.

It’s still unclear whether Tudor will use a three-man defence, which he has deployed in recent years, including a successful three-month spell at Lazio last season.

Ilbianconero.com suggests that Locatelli could be one of the three central defenders against Genoa, even if Federico Gatti, Pierre Kalulu and Renato Veiga also have solid chances of getting the nod at the back.

However, Locatelli will surely be the Juventus captain, while Teun Koopmeiners may start on the bench, making room for Kenan Yildiz and Kolo Muani behind Vlahovic in attack.

Generally, both Tudor and Motta love counter-pressing and aim to recover the ball high up the pitch. However, the Croatian tactician prefers vertical passes and quick counter-attacks to a build-up with extreme ball possession.

The ex-Juventus defender took charge of his first training session on Monday but could rely on the full team only later in the week, when all players returned from international duty.

Juventus will be without the injured Gleison Bremer, Juan Cabal, Arkadiusz Milik, Douglas Luiz and Andrea Cambiaso for Tudor’s debut against Genoa tomorrow.
